Sweeping Miniatures, I mean the Giants. The series started off with a gutty performance by Brad Penny. Despite the fact that he did not have his best stuff, he toughed it out, and willed the Dodgers to victory. Not to mention the great defensive plays by Russell Martin that saved the game. On Saturday, Derek Lowe rebounded from his shaky opening day start, and and shut down the team by the bay. He went seven strong innings, and never allowed the Giants offense to get started. The little know Wilson Valdez, who everyone keeps confusing with Wilson Alvarez (just the thought of confusing those two is ridiculous) had a great all around game. He got some key knocks and made some spectacular plays at short. As for Sunday, the Dodgers went up against my one time favorite player, Barry Zito. The Dodgers offense pounded Zito all day, and this game was basically over after the second. Now we look forward to today, as we open up at home against the Colorado Rockies. Lets keep it going!
